Lesional T cells in CU …the presence of activated T cells in the dermis may play a role in the pathogenesis of the skin lesions in CU.

Mekori YA et al. J Allergy Clin Immunol 72:681, 1983

…Our results suggest that the infiltrate resembles that observed in cellular immune reactions (although no antigen has been identified) and that interaction of T-lymphocytes and/or monocytes with mast cells to cause mediator release appears likely.

Elias J et al. J Allergy Clin Immunol 78:914, 1986

Points in Favour of Pathogenic Ab in CIU

• Passive transfer of autologous ST to healthy volunteers

(Adv Dermatol 15:311, 1999)

• Correlation of functional autoAb plasma levels with severity (Lancet 339:1078, 1992)

• Disease remission following removal (plasmapheresis) or suppression (IVIG) of the antibody (BJD 138:101,1998)

Thyroid Autoimmunity in Chronic Urticaria

27% of patients with CU have anti thyroid Ab. 19% have abnormal thyroid functionKaplan AP N Eng J Med 346:175, 2002

24% of patients with CIU had at least one type of anti thyroid Ab. 42% of the seropositive pt. had thyroid disease or altered TSH levels. Zauli D et al Allergy Asthma Proc 22:93, 2001 10 euthyroid patients with CU. 7/10 had anti thyroid Ab. All seven reported resolution of symptoms within 4 wk of thyroxine treatment. Other 3 patients did not respond. 5 patients had a recurrence of symptoms after treatment was stopped, which resolved after treatment was restarted.TSH decreased in all pt. With a clinical response.Rumbyrt JS et al J Allergy Clin Immunol 96:901, 1996

Clinical and laboratory parameters in predicting chronic urticaria duration: a prospective study of 139 patients

139 patients with CU70% > 1 year14% >5 years

CU duration is associated with clinical parameters such as:

•severity and angioedema

•autologous serum test and anti-thyroid antibodies

Toubi E et al Allergy 59:869, 2004

Potential Causes of Chronic Urticaria

• Occupational/Contactants• Medications• Foods/additives/CAM products (Echinacea; Ann Allergy 88:42, 2002)

• Physical• Infections (viral; focal)• Autoimmune (SLE; MCTD; thyroiditis; FcRI)• Vasculitis (less than 1%)• Hormonal dysfunctiuon (thyroid; pregnancy; menstrual)• Malignancy• Mastocytosis

Cholinergic Urticaria

Eleven of 17 patients with cholinergic urticaria showed positive reactions in skin tests with their own diluted sweat .

Substantial amounts of sweat-induced histamine release from autologous basophils were observed in 10 of 17 patients. Eight of 15 patients with cholinergic urticaria showed positive reactions in the autologous serum skin tests. All 6 patients who developed satellite wheals after the acetylcholine test showed hypersensitivity to sweat. Further, patients whose eruptions were coincident with hair follicles showed positive responses to the skin test with autologous serum, whereas patients whose eruptions were not coincident with hair follicles did not.

Fukunaga A et al J allergy Clin Immunol 116: 397, 2005

CU-Experimental Therapies

• Cyclosporine (2.5-4 mg/kg); Tacrolimus (70% response rate)

• Plasmapheresis (pts. with FcRI Ab)

• IVIG

• Levothyroxine (for pts. with thyroid Ab)• Anti IgE mAb (effect on FcRI expression)
